Kirsten Storms Shares: "Maxie's Short Hair Returns To GH … And So Do I."

Photo Credit: HutchinsPhoto.com
In a post on her Instagram account on Friday night, General Hospital fan favorite Kirsten Storms (Maxies Jones) posted a photo of herself about to get her cut-off. But what is even more important is that Storms confirmed she is already back taping brand new episodes for the summer on the set of the ABC daytime drama series.
Storms post stated: “Maxie’s short hair returns to #GH … and so do I.”
The return of Kirsten is very key to the summer storyline involving; Nathan (Ryan Paevey), Claudette (Bree Williamson), and Griffin (Matt Cohen). In Storms absense former Days of our Lives cast member, Molly Burnett (Ex-Melanie Jonas) had temporarily replaced her.
Look for Burnett to debut next week on GH, with Storms returning to her role on-air in August.

GENERAL HOSPITAL Preview: Serena Sets Her Sights on Michael; Jason’s Emotional Exit from the Mob

This week on all-new episodes of General Hospital, new and old motivations come into play with dangerous consequences. According to the just released GH video spoilers video for the week of August 3-7, a bailiff calls out, “All rise!”
Now it’s Isaiah (Sawandi Wilson) vs. Curtis (Donnell Turner), as the surgeon is suing the owner of the Savoy for assault that ruined is ability to operate. At the end of the day, which of these men has enough evidence against the other? Portia (Brook Kerr) is by Isaiah’s side, while Jordan (Tanisha Harper) is with Curtis.
Next, Lucy (Lynn Herring) has a plan to get the controlling shares of Deception away from Michael (Rory Gibson). She wants her daughter, Serena (Kelly Kruger) to seduce Michael. She tells her, “Pick out your most seductive suit.” Soon, we see Serena in her bathing suit at the Metro Court face to face with Michael.
Later, there is a small baggie containing three blue pills. Nina (Cynthia Watros) ask Willow (Katelyn MacMullen), “What did you do?” We also see Michael asking the same thing of Jacinda (Paige Herschell). Leading into this week, viewers know that Willow doesn’t want the former escort anywhere near her children, Amelia and Wiley. Is this how she stops her, or is Jacinda up to old tricks and wants to frame Willow? Remember when Jacindsa drugged Drew (Cameron Mathison)? Stay tuned.
Finally, in the pick-up from last Friday’s cliffhanger, an emotional Jason (Steve Burton) continues to tell Sonny (Maurice Benard) that he cannot work for him anymore. Sonny ask, “So that’s it? You’re Out?” We fade to black.

Vincent Pastore of ‘Sopranos’ Fame and ‘General Hospital’s’ Maximus Giambetti Dies at 80

Vincent Pastore, best known for his memorable role as Salvatore “Big Pussy” Bonpensiero on HBO’s The Sopranos has passed away.
The veteran actor was found dead on August 1st in his home in the Bronx, New York. Pastore was 80-years-old. The cause of death is yet to be determined.
As well as his role on The Sopranos, many soap fans will recall he played multiple smaller roles on the beloved One Life to Live from 1995 and 2004. However, in 2008, he landed the short-term role as Maximus Giambetti on General Hospital.

PASTORE WANTED TO BE ON GENERAL HOSPITAL
Maximus was the mobster father of Sonny Corinthos’ (Maurice Benard) bodyguards: Max (Derk Cheetwood) and Milo (Drew Cheetwood)
According to Soap Opera Digest, Pastore told Soaps In Depth back in 2009, after appearing in a SOAPnet promotional campaign as a celebrity fan of General Hospital: “‘I’d love to be on the show. So they called up GH’s casting director (Mark Teschner) and Bobby (Robert Guza Jr. ex-head writer, GH) and they wrote me in!”
Pastore was a huge General Hospital fan from way back, who at one point told producers that he would watch the ABC soap opera while working in bars and nightclubs in the 70s and 80s.
Throughout his decades long career, Pastore appeared in films including: Goodfellas, Carlito’s Way and Men of Respect, The Jerky Boys: The Movie and the 1996 HBO TV movie Gotti.
In TV, besides The Sopranos, Pastore’s credits included: Law & Order, The Practice, Son of the Beach, Queens Supreme, Hawaii Five-0, Wu-Tang: An American Saga, plus the miniseries The Last Don II. Most recently, Vincent was a series regular on Gravesend and guest starred on Yellowjackets.
Pastore is survived by his daughter, Renee, son-in-law and granddaughter.
